Summary
Wilder Penfield discovered that focal microgyria can cause epilepsy. This paper details the first surgically treated case, highlighting a significant, overlooked contribution to neurobiology and epilepsy surgery.
Area of Science:
- Neurobiology
- Epileptology
- Neurosurgery
Background:
- Wilder Penfield was a pivotal figure in 20th-century neurobiology.
- His work significantly advanced understanding of brain function and epilepsy surgery.
- A key discovery regarding microgyria as a cause of epilepsy has been largely overlooked.
Purpose of the Study:
- To provide a comprehensive account of the first documented case of focal epilepsy caused by microgyria.
- To detail the surgical treatment and successful outcome of this case.
- To highlight Penfield's overlooked discovery linking microgyria to epilepsy.
Main Methods:
- Review of primary source documents, including patient charts and operative notes from the Montreal Neurological Institute archives.
- Analysis of Penfield's 1939 Shattuck Lecture.
- Examination of intraoperative photographs, brain maps, and histopathological/cytological findings of the resected specimen.
Main Results:
- Detailed reconstruction of the first case where microgyria was identified as the cause of focal epilepsy.
- Confirmation of successful surgical treatment for this specific case.
- Evidence supporting Penfield's recognition of microgyria's role in generating seizures.
Conclusions:
- Microgyria is a recognized cause of focal epilepsy.
- Surgical intervention can effectively treat epilepsy associated with microgyria.
- This case underscores the importance of Penfield's foundational contributions to epilepsy research and treatment.
